    1. Praise the father day by day.

    1.Legend has it that the ancient warrior Kuafu was burly and powerful, and thought that there was nothing in the world that could not be done, and he took a cane to chase the sun, and he climbed many mountains and crossed many rivers, and he was exhausted and did not catch the sun. He did not give up, and kept looking for it until he was almost at the edge of the lake, when he was overworked.

    Second, Jingwei reclamation.

    Jingwei reclamation is one of the Chinese folk legends. Jingwei was originally the youngest daughter of Emperor Yan Shennong's family, named Nuwa, and one day the girl went to the East China Sea to play and drowned in the water. After death, the uneven elf turned into a kind of sacred bird with a flower head, a white beak shell, and red claws, and every day brought stones and plants from the mountains, threw them into the East China Sea, and then emitted a mournful cry of "Jingwei, Jingwei", as if calling to himself.

    3. Hou Yi shoots the sun.

    1.Hou Yi tells the story of how once upon a time there were ten suns sleeping under the branches, and they took turns to run out to watch the sky and shine on the earth. But once, they came out together and brought disaster to humanity.

    In order to save mankind, Hou Yi stretched his bow and arrows and shot at the 9 suns. I saw a burst of fireball in the sky, and a three-legged crow fell. In the end, only one sun was left in the sky.

    1, "The Cowherd and the Weaver Girl":

    The Cowherd and the Weaver Girl is one of the most famous folk legends in our country, and it is the earliest story about the stars of our people.

    There is such a paragraph in Ren Fang's "Narrative of Differences" in the Northern and Southern Dynasties: "In the east of the great river, there is a beautiful woman, who is the son of the Emperor of Heaven, a female worker of the machine, working hard every year, weaving into a cloud and mist silk cloth, hard work is not happy, the appearance is not flawless, the Emperor of Heaven pities his solitude, marries the morning glory in Hexi as his wife, and since then the work of weaving has been abolished, and the greed and joy do not return." The emperor is angry, blames Hedong, and meets once a year.

    2, "The Legend of the White Snake":

    The earliest formation story is recorded in the twenty-eighth volume of Feng Menglong's "Warning Words", "The White Lady Yongzhen Leifeng Tower".

    In the early years of the Qing Dynasty, Huang Tujue's "Leifeng Pagoda" (Kanshan Pavilion Ben) was the earliest collation of the opera of text creation and circulation, and he only wrote that the white snake was suppressed under the Leifeng Pagoda, and did not give birth to the tower. Later, the old manuscript of Liyuan (probably composed by Chen Jiayan's father and daughter, the existing music score is incomplete), is a widely circulated book, with the plot of the white snake giving birth to a child.

    3, "Meng Jiangnu Crying on the Great Wall":

    This is a famous folk tale in ancient China. It is widely disseminated in the form of dramas, ballads, poems, raps, etc. Legend has it that during the reign of Qin Shi Huang, a young man and woman, Fan Xiliang and Jiang Nu, were married for three days.

    The bridegroom was forced to set out to build the Great Wall. Soon after, he died of hunger, cold, and overwork.

    Jiang Nu wore cold clothes and went to the Great Wall to find her husband. But what she gets is sad news for her husband. Three days and three nights later, the entire city collapsed, revealing Fan Xiliang's body. Jiang Nu committed suicide by throwing herself into the sea in desperation.

    4, "Liang Shanbo and Zhu Yingtai":

    The legend of Liang Zhu is the most powerful art of oral transmission in China, and the only one that has a wide influence in the world is folklore. The story of Liang Zhu has been passed down for more than 1,460 years. This song is a household name in China and is widely circulated, and is known as the "swan song of the ages".

    5, "Mulan in the Army":

    tells the ancient story of Mulan going to war instead of her father. Mulan was a folk woman in ancient times. Practicing horseback riding since she was a child, she was encountering the emperor's recruitment, her father's name was also on the roster, her father was incompetent due to old age and illness, so Mulan disguised herself as ** and went out for her father.

    Mulan's participation in the army reflects Mulan's heroic spirit of defending the family and the country, and she also has the feelings of a daughter who honors her father.
